Tallinn Airport Information

Tallinn
Tallinn is the capital city of Estonia. It lies on the southern coast of the Gulf of Finland. The city is located almost 70 kilometres south of Helsinki. Tallinn city is famous for its historical and medieval heart which is located on the hill of Toompea. Covered in cobbled streets and full-filled with medieval houses and alleyways, the city makes it a wonderful tourist destination. It is one of the most oldest and the famous capital cities in Northern Europe. The city was well-known as Reval from the 13th century until 1917. The city witnesses a humid continental weather with warm, mild summers and cold, snowy winter season. Generally winters are cold but mild due to its latitude, owing to its coastal position. Some of the major tourist attractions are in the two old towns including Lower Town and Toompea that lure a large number of tourists across the world. Some of the famous Eastern districts around Pirita and Kadriorg are considered as worth visiting and the Estonian Open Air Museum (Eesti Vabaõhumuuseum) in Rocca al Mare, west of the city, maintains the major aspects of Estonian rural culture and architecture. Other major tourist sightseeing are Medieval Old Town, Tallinn Botanical Gardens, Kadriorg Palace, Song Festival Grounds, Viru Gate, (Entrance to Viru Street), Raekoja Plats, Raekoda (Town Hall),Toompea Hill, Alexander Nevsky Cathedral, Museum of Occupations, City Wall, St Mary's Cathedral– Toomkirik and so on. Some of the famous festivals and events of Tallinn are Tallinn Winter Festival, Tallinn Music Week, Tallinn International Festival Jazzkaar, Birgitta Festival and many others. About Dubai (DXB)

Dubai will lead you into a historical sojourn like no other place in the world. The primary history of this city’s establishment is not that well documented; however, research suggests that this land is close to 4,000 years old. Modern Dubai has evolved from fishing populations, which existed along the coast of the Arabian Gulf during the 1830s. The Dubai Creek was an ancient port of trade, very busy during times of trade between Indus Valley and Mesopotamian civilizations. The historic finds that give us insight into this ancient city lie preserved as artefacts in the archaeological section of the Dubai Museum.

Dubai is the second largest emirate among the seven that exist as the United Arab Emirates. It is located on the southern shore of the Gulf. The city is known to house one of the world’s most curated experiences. A bustling metropolitan steeped in culture and tradition, Dubai is the epitome of the amalgamation of western luxury and mid-western morals. The region is characterized under “desert vegetation” for a reason, for the temperature here remains high all year long. Dubai enjoys a sub-tropical, arid climate. Large populations of expats live here, including Arab, Asians, and European.

 

How to reach Dubai

 

By Air – The main airport in Dubai is the Dubai International Airport. All major airlines fly to this airport on a daily basis. Emirates Airlines is the preferable and national carrier that operates flights to Dubai. The Sharjah International Airport is another important node here, although only a few airlines land and take off from there. A taxi ride from the airport to the main city costs about 50 Dirham.

 

By Bus – Daily buses connect Dubai to the other emirates. The Emirates Express plies on a frequented route from everywhere in the Emirates, including Sharjah, Ajman, Masafi, and Abu Dhabi.

 

By Road – One can drive from Oman to Dubai across the international borders without needing a permit or fee upon entering Dubai; however, an exit fee of 3,000 Omani Rial will be charged upon leaving Oman. Make sure you retain the slip as the receipt must be produced during the return trip.

 

What to do in Dubai

 

A few decades ago, Dubai was a land of strong winds carrying the desert soil over and about the vast cityscape. It used to be a land of sparsely scattered skyscrapers. Presently, however, it is a widely populated metropolitan, which houses post-modern tall buildings, and within the alleys, retains the charm of the Old Dubai Town. It is the perfect amalgamation of tradition and modernism. Explore the city, which is referred to as one of the most affluent in the world, soaking in the olden culture of the Arabs alongside the buzzing nightlife that’s on offer.

Whether scouring the city’s popular spots, like visiting the traditional establishments, modern architectural marvels, a man-made beach and the best flea markets in all of the Emirates, tourists to Dubai have a many options to choose from:

Many operators offer private safaris across the wildlife and desert attractions in the vicinity. For night safaris, tourists are taken to an area 20 minutes away from downtown Dubai.

Apart from safaris, ATV tours, camel rides in the dunes, and hot air balloon rides are also popular activities most enthusiasts.
